Transaction 04e41c6aca421cbf04859ce3890736f376b4c946bb4958da40c8c6145a98e304

1 Input
2 Outputs
  • 04e41c6aca421cbf04859ce3890736f376b4c946bb4958da40c8c6145a98e304:0
  • value  76594000
    address  18bFzd6PURB3DDvLzKjewtw6qczGXhQpYA
  • 04e41c6aca421cbf04859ce3890736f376b4c946bb4958da40c8c6145a98e304:1
  • value  305103213
    address  3733Ug19t3s98tVo5KRy5pASp6USEUHffc